Mugabe declared Zimbabwe presidential election winner

Sunday, 29 June 2008

Robert Mugabe's been declared the winner of this week's presidential run-off in Zimbabwe.

He was the only candidate in the election following the withdrawal of Morgan Tsvangirai due to violence and intimidation against his supporters.

Pressure is now mounting on African leaders, who are gathering in Egypt for this week's African Union Summit to take action against Mr Mugabe.

Archbishop Desmond Tutu has said that he wants to see the African Union reject the election result.
